};






#define	svc_bad				0
#define	svc_nop				1
#define	svc_disconnect		2
#define	svc_updatestat		3	// [qbyte] [qbyte]
//#define	svc_version			4	// [long] server version (not used anywhere)
#define	svc_nqsetview			5	// [short] entity number
#define	svc_sound			6	// <see code>
#define	svc_nqtime			7	// [float] server time
#define	svc_print			8	// [qbyte] id [string] null terminated string
#define	svc_stufftext		9	// [string] stuffed into client's console buffer
								// the string should be \n terminated
#define	svc_setangle		10	// [angle3] set the view angle to this absolute value

#define	svc_serverdata		11	// [long] protocol ...
#define	svc_lightstyle		12	// [qbyte] [string]
#define	svc_nqupdatename		13	// [qbyte] [string]
#define	svc_updatefrags		14	// [qbyte] [short]
#define	svc_nqclientdata		15	// <shortbits + data>
//#define	svc_stopsound		16	// <see code> (not used anywhere)
#define	svc_nqupdatecolors	17	// [qbyte] [qbyte] [qbyte]
#define	svc_particle		18	// [vec3] <variable>
#define	svc_damage			19

#define	svc_spawnstatic		20
//#define	svc_spawnstatic2	21 (not used anywhere)
#define	svc_spawnbaseline	22

#define	svc_temp_entity		23	// variable
#define	svc_setpause		24	// [qbyte] on / off
#define	svc_nqsignonnum		25	// [qbyte]  used for the signon sequence

#define	svc_centerprint		26	// [string] to put in center of the screen

#define	svc_killedmonster	27
#define	svc_foundsecret		28

#define	svc_spawnstaticsound	29	// [coord3] [qbyte] samp [qbyte] vol [qbyte] aten

#define	svc_intermission	30		// [vec3_t] origin [vec3_t] angle (show scoreboard and stuff)
#define	svc_finale			31		// [string] text ('congratulations blah blah')

#define	svc_cdtrack			32		// [qbyte] track
#define svc_sellscreen		33

//#define svc_cutscene		34	//hmm... nq only... added after qw tree splitt? (intermission without the scores)

#define	svc_smallkick		34		// set client punchangle to 2
#define	svc_bigkick			35		// set client punchangle to 4

#define	svc_updateping		36		// [qbyte] [short]
#define	svc_updateentertime	37		// [qbyte] [float]

#define	svc_updatestatlong	38		// [qbyte] [long]

#define	svc_muzzleflash		39		// [short] entity

#define	svc_updateuserinfo	40		// [qbyte] slot [long] uid
									// [string] userinfo

#define	svc_download		41		// [short] size [size bytes]
#define	svc_playerinfo		42		// variable
#define	svc_nails			43		// [qbyte] num [48 bits] xyzpy 12 12 12 4 8
#define	svc_chokecount		44		// [qbyte] packets choked
#define	svc_modellist		45		// [strings]
#define	svc_soundlist		46		// [strings]
#define	svc_packetentities	47		// [...]
#define	svc_deltapacketentities	48		// [...]
#define svc_maxspeed		49		// maxspeed change, for prediction
#define svc_entgravity		50		// gravity change, for prediction
#define svc_setinfo			51		// setinfo on a client
#define svc_serverinfo		52		// serverinfo
#define svc_updatepl		53		// [qbyte] [qbyte]
#define svc_nails2			54		//mvd only - [qbyte] num [52 bits] nxyzpy 8 12 12 12 4 8
